Broccoli and Cheddar Cheese Soup

 

 
 
2.4_recipe_broccoliBy Deirdre Imus, The Imus Ranch Cooking for Kids and Cowboys


Cooking Time: 20 to 25 minutes 

Truly creamy and delicious, this velvety soup offers the perfect balance of vegetable and cheese flavors! The soup will keep in the refrigerator, tightly covered in a glass container, for two or three days. Reheat it over a very low flame to avoid scorching. 



 

    Preparation Time: 15 to 20 minutes
    2 heads broccoli, cut into florets
    ½ cup olive oil
    1 medium mild yellow onion, diced
    1 clove garlic, peeled and sliced thin
    4 cups vegetable broth
    1 cup grated soy cheddar cheese or sharp cheddar cheese
    1 cup soy milk or organic milk
    ¼ cup unbleached white flour
    1 tablespoon salt
    ½ teaspoon freshly ground black pepper

Bring a medium saucepan of water to a boil. Add the broccoli, and cook 1 to 2 minutes, until bright green. Rinse the broccoli and drain well. Heat ¼ cup of the oil in a medium stockpot over medium heat. When the oil is shimmering, add the onion and garlic; sauté until tender, about 5 minutes. Combine the onion mixture, broccoli, and half the vegetable broth in the container of a food processor; process until smooth. Add the mixture to the pot and stir in the remainder of the broth; bring to a boil and lower to a simmer. Slowly stir the cheese and soy milk into the soup; continue to simmer 2 to 3 minutes.

Heat the remaining ¼ cup of oil in a sauté pan and stir in the flour. Cook, stirring, until the mixture is smooth and has turned golden brown, about 2 minutes. Stir the flour mixture into the soup just until it is thickened. Add the salt and pepper, adjusting to taste. Remove from the heat immediately and serve.

Makes 10 servings
